[0003] The current natural gas hydrate exploitation methods mainly include heat injection exploitation, depressurization exploitation, chemical reagent injection exploitation, CO 2 Displacement mining and solid-state fluidization mining (deep-sea shallow layer), etc., but these methods have certain shortcomings, such as serious heat loss in heat injection mining, expensive chemical reagents, etc., and these methods are easy to cause deformation of the seabed, causing seabed Landslides, tsunamis, marine ecological environment damage and other disasters
Therefore, there are certain hidden dangers in large-scale commercial mining using the above methods at present.

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for exploiting of submarine natural gas hydrate through solid replacement and pressure maintaining, and belongs to the field of energy and environments. The method comprises the steps that by arranging a stope at a hydrate layer, the stope temperature and pressure are monitored by using a temperature and pressure sensor and fed back to an offshore platform, existing conditions of the hydrate are maintained by adopting a sealing device according to a hydrate temperature and pressure curve, the hydrate is made to be not disintegrated, the solid form of the hydrate is maintained, solid-state mechanization mining, solid-liquid slurry conveying, gas separation and liquefaction transport are further conducted on the hydrate, a separated hydrate skeleton is brokenagain, and a cavity is filled after a rapid solidification material is added, thus destroy of submarine landslide, tsunami and a submarine ecological environment can be effectively prevented, and thepurpose of green exploiting is achieved. According to the method for exploiting of the submarine natural gas hydrate through solid replacement and pressure maintaining, the system is simple, and themethod is suitable for a hydrate pressure bearing layer with an upper impermeable cover layer and a lower impermeable cover layer, and has a good application prospect.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of exploiting seabed natural gas hydrate, in particular to a method for exploiting seabed natural gas hydrate by solid replacement and pressure maintenance. Background technique [0002] Natural gas hydrate is a white crystalline substance formed by gas molecules and water under low temperature and high pressure conditions. It is mainly produced in seabed sediments and land permafrost, and the global resources are estimated to reach 2.1×10 16 m 3 , is twice the total amount of coal, oil and natural gas resources, and has huge potential for energy development.
